Towing System - Electrically Deployable Tow Bar
The XF Sportbrake bespoke towing system is optimised to work alongside the Trailer Stability Assist traction control system. This system detects when a dangerous trailer sway situation is developing and helps to regain control by gradually reducing speed through cutting engine power and applying the brakes. The towing system features an electrically deployed tow ball offering towing capability of up 2,000kg, 100kg nose load. The electrically deployable tow ball has been designed to fit discreetly behind the bumper, providing a clean attractive finish. The system includes 13 pin towing electrics. Rear bumper valance (dependent on engine derivative) and towing module are required for fitment and need to be ordered separately. Jaguar towing electrics are capable of powering caravans, trailers or lighting boards including those fitted with rear mounted LED lamp kits. However there is a minimum current required which some auxiliary lighting may not support. Please refer to the Owner's Handbook for details of the minimum and maximum electrical loading supported.
